Oracle PL/SQL初学者指南:从基础到进阶
需积分: 9 42 浏览量
更新于2024-11-30
收藏 707KB PDF 举报
"Oracle PL/SQL语言初级教程.pdf" 是一本适合Oracle初学者的指南,涵盖了PL/SQL语言的基础知识,包括语言结构、复合数据类型、函数、表和视图、完整性约束以及过程和函数等内容。
Oracle PL/SQL是Oracle数据库系统中用于编写存储过程、函数、触发器等数据库编程的组件,它结合了SQL的查询和更新功能与高级编程语言的控制结构。在基础部分,教程详细介绍了PL/SQL如何作为一个基于事务处理的语言,能够在任何Oracle环境下运行,并支持所有的数据处理命令。
关于复合数据类型,教程深入讲解了记录和集合。记录是由不同域组成的结构,集合则包含多个元素。学习者将了解到如何定义和操作这两种复合数据类型,这包括它们的类型、创建方法以及实际应用。
函数是PL/SQL中的重要组成部分,分为单行函数和组函数。单行函数作用于一行数据,而组函数则处理多行数据,如SUM、AVG等。教程详细阐述了这些函数的使用方法和应用场景。
在数据库结构方面,教程涵盖表和视图的概念。表是数据存储的基本单元,可能包含分区和对象表。视图则是从一个或多个表中选取数据的逻辑表示。学习者将学习到如何创建和管理这些数据库对象。
完整性约束是确保数据质量的关键,它们是定义在数据字典中的规则,可以在执行SQL或PL/SQL时动态启用或禁用。完整性约束帮助防止错误的数据输入,保持数据库的一致性。
最后,教程探讨了过程和函数的差异及其使用。过程和函数都是预编译并存储在数据库中的代码块,但函数必须有返回值,而过程则没有。两者的调用方式和参数处理是它们的主要区别。
此外,教程还涉及SQL的基本类别,包括数据查询语言(DQL)、数据操纵语言(DML)、数据定义语言(DDL)和数据控制语言(DCL),这些都是数据库操作的核心概念。
通过这个初级教程,初学者将能够掌握Oracle PL/SQL的基础知识,为进一步的数据库开发和管理打下坚实的基础。
2018-12-21 上传
2008-08-26 上传
1290 浏览量
2020-05-28 上传
2011-02-17 上传
2010-01-19 上传
点击了解资源详情
2011-10-17 上传
2008-11-25 上传
meiwenzm
- 粉丝: 14
- 资源: 11
最新资源
- Python中快速友好的MessagePack序列化库msgspec
- 大学生社团管理系统设计与实现
- 基于Netbeans和JavaFX的宿舍管理系统开发与实践
- NodeJS打造Discord机器人:kazzcord功能全解析
- 小学教学与管理一体化:校务管理系统v***
- AppDeploy neXtGen:无需代理的Windows AD集成软件自动分发
- 基于SSM和JSP技术的网上商城系统开发
- 探索ANOIRA16的GitHub托管测试网站之路
- 语音性别识别:机器学习模型的精确度提升策略
- 利用MATLAB代码让古董486电脑焕发新生
- Erlang VM上的分布式生命游戏实现与Elixir设计
- 一键下载管理 - Go to Downloads-crx插件
- Java SSM框架开发的客户关系管理系统
- 使用SQL数据库和Django开发应用程序指南
- Spring Security实战指南:详细示例与应用
- Quarkus项目测试展示柜:Cucumber与FitNesse实践